AT&T 'hotter,' passes T-Mobile USA with 48,000 hot spots

AT&T Inc. has substantially expanded its network of Wi-Fi hot spots, adding 13,000 new locations around the world for more than 48,000 total. That figure surpasses the roughly 45,000 Wi-Fi hot spots of T-Mobile USA Inc., which has traditionally been a leader in the space.

According to T-Mobile USA’s Web site, the carrier has about 8,370 hot spots in the United States and an additional 37,000 locations overseas for roaming. AT&T says it now has nearly 15,000 hot spots in the U.S., close to double the number offered by T-Mobile USA.

T-Mobile USA’s hot spot locations include Starbucks coffee shops, Borders Books and Music stores, airline clubs and hotels including Red Roof Inns, Hyatt Hotels and Resorts, and Sofitel and Novotel Hotels, as well as various airports.

AT&T, meanwhile, specified that its service is offered at airports, restaurants, coffee shops and hospitals including the UC Davis Health System in California and the Central Dupage Hospital in Illinois; several Juan Valdez Cafes in New York, Washington, D.C., and Seattle; and the Addison conference and theatre centre in Texas.
